Block

#12,267,572
Block Number
12,267,572 @ 05/22/2022, 05:23:40
Status
Finalized
ID
0x00bb3034729f52ecb533310c7ff346698eb9d63763edca0ade531262a263ea64
Transactions
Gas Used
14607141/15273833 (95.64% Used)
Total Score
1,189,960,908 (+98)
Rewards
43.82 VTHO